Plainfield East lost against Naperville North back in May of 2021, and unfortunately they wound up with the same result on Saturday. The Plainfield East Bengals fell 7-3 to the Naperville North Huskies. Plainfield East has now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
Natalie Utrata and Ashley Plzak did some serious damage despite the final result: Utrata went 1-for-4 with a home run and two runs, while Plzak went 1-for-4 with a home run and two RBI.
On Naperville North's side, Ava Matthews sp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ered three earned runs on eight hits and racked up ten Ks.
On the hitting side, Olivia Hebron was a standout: she scored three runs and stole a base while going 2-for-3. The team also got some help courtesy of Sara Rossi, who scored two runs and stole a base while going 3-for-4.
Plainfield East's loss dropped their record down to 7-11. As for Naperville North, their victory bumped their record up to 8-14.
Plainfield East will look to defend their home field on Monday against Yorkville at 4:30 p.m. Yorkville is coming into the match with four straight defeats on the road, meaning Plainfield East will have to defend against a squad hungry for a win. As for Naperville North, they will face off against Waubonsie Valley at 4:30 p.m. on Monday. Waubonsie Valley is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 7 runs per game this season.
